Why Lug Nut Size Matters

You might be wondering, “Why should I care about lug nut size? Aren’t all lug nuts the same?” Well, not quite. Lug nut size matters because using the correct size ensures a snug fit between the lug nut and the wheel stud. This snug fit is vital for maintaining proper wheel alignment, preventing vibrations, and maximizing your safety on the road. Plus, using the wrong size lug nuts can lead to stripped threads, wobbly wheels, and a whole lot of trouble down the line.

Lug Nut Love: Tips for Maintenance

Now that you’re armed with the knowledge of the right lug nut size for your Dodge Ram 1500 TRX, let’s wrap things up with some quick tips for keeping your lug nuts and wheels in tip-top shape:

  • Torque Matters: When tightening your lug nuts, make sure to use a torque wrench to apply the right amount of force. This prevents over-tightening or under-tightening, both of which can cause problems.
  • Regular Inspections: Give your lug nuts a visual check every now and then. If you notice any rust, corrosion, or damage, it’s time to replace them.
  • Seasonal Changes: Extreme temperatures can affect the integrity of your lug nuts. Keep an eye on them, especially after harsh winters or scorching summers.

The Torque Application Tango

Okay, so now you know the numbers. But how do you actually apply torque like a pro? Follow these simple steps:

  1. Prep Your Tools: Get a quality torque wrench and the right socket. Like a knight and his sword, your torque wrench is your trusty companion in this torque-taming journey.
  2. Clean the Threads: Before attaching your wheels, make sure those threads are clean as a whistle. No one likes a dirty connection!
  3. Hand-Tighten First: Start by hand-tightening the nuts. Think of it as a friendly handshake before the real deal.
  4. Follow the Sequence: Tighten the nuts in a star pattern. This helps distribute torque evenly, just like spreading butter on toast!
  5. Torque Time: Set your torque wrench to the appropriate value from the chart. Now, gently and precisely, apply torque in the same star pattern. It’s like a torque waltz!
